The number 209 is a composite number because it is divisible by 11 . A prime number is a number that can only be divisible by the number 1 and itself. But the number 209 is not only divisible by 1 and itself. It is also divisible by 11 and 19. So the number 209 is a composite number.209 is a Composite Number

To find the mean of the numbers, add all the numbers and divide by how many numbers are in the list: 190 + 209 +243 + 288 + 317 = 1247 1247 divided by 5 = 249.4 To find the median, list the numbers from smallest to largest. The median is the number in the middle: 243 The mode is the number that is repeated more than any other. This list of numbers has no mode.
